.pp__container a,.pp__container li,.pp__container p,.pp__container span{font-family:Metropolis,Helvetica,Arial,sans-serif;font-size:16px}.pp__container p{line-height:1.1em}.pp__container h1{font-family:open_sans,Helvetica,Arial,sans-serif;font-weight:100;font-size:36px;margin:0;-webkit-font-smoothing:antialiased}.pp__container i{color:#dadada;cursor:pointer}.pp__container i:hover{color:#606060}.pp__container h2{font-family:Metropolis,Helvetica,Arial,sans-serif;font-weight:700;color:#606060;margin:0;font-size:28px;-webkit-font-smoothing:antialiased}.pp__container h3{font-family:Metropolis,Helvetica,Arial,sans-serif;font-size:16px;font-weight:700}.pp__container a{color:#38407a;text-decoration:none;border-bottom:2px solid transparent}.pp__container a:hover{border-bottom:2px solid #38407a}.pp__container,.pp__container div{box-sizing:border-box}.pp__container{background-color:#fff;width:100%;display:-webkit-flex;display:flex;padding:20px 40px}.pp__left-col{flex:1 1 0;min-width:0;padding-right:20px}.pp__right-col{flex:0 0 470px;padding-left:20px;position:relative}.pp__header-accolades{margin:10px 0 0}.pp__header-accolades img{vertical-align:text-bottom}.pp__header-accolades a{margin-right:15px}.pp__header-accolades i{color:#38407a}.pp__header a.accolades-manufacturer-url,a.accolades-manufacturer-url i,a.accolades-manufacturer-url i:hover{font-weight:700;color:#4cb90e}a.accolades-manufacturer-url:hover{color:#4cb90e;border-bottom:2px solid #4cb90e}.pp__product-images{margin:10px auto 0;max-width:540px;max-height:300px;position:relative}.pp__product-images img{max-height:300px}.pp__mystudiocounts{display:-webkit-flex;display:flex;-webkit-justify-content:center;justify-content:center;margin:10px 0 0;width:100%;height:42px}.pp__mystudiocounts-card{height:100%;width:84px;border:1px solid #dadada;border-radius:3px;background-color:#f7f7f7;margin:0 5px;box-sizing:border-box;cursor:pointer;text-align:center}.pp__mystudiocounts-card:hover{border-color:#606060}.pp__mystudiocounts-card--true{background-color:#fff}.pp__mystudiocounts-card span{display:inline-block;width:100%;font-size:13px}.pp__mystudiocounts-card .count{font-size:14px;font-weight:800;margin-top:5px}.pp__header-shortcut-links{margin:10px 0 0;text-align:center}.pp__header-shortcut-links a{display:inline-block;margin:0 15px}.pp__highlights-card{margin:40px 0 0}.pp__highlights-card-header{padding:0 0 5px;border-bottom:2px solid #606060;margin:0 0 10px}.pp__discussion-highlight{margin-top:26px}.pp__discussion-highlight p .gearLink{color:#38407a!important}.pp__discussion-highlight>a h3{display:inline-block;margin:0}.pp__discussion-highlight>a{color:initial}.pp__discussion-highlight>a:hover{border-bottom:2px solid #000}a.pp__discussion-highlight-button{display:inline-block;border:2px solid #38407a;border-radius:5px;width:120px;padding:6px 0;font-size:13px;text-align:center;font-weight:700;-webkit-font-smoothing:antialiased;cursor:pointer}a.pp__discussion-highlight-button i{vertical-align:text-bottom;color:#fff}a.pp__discussion-highlight-button:hover{background-color:#38407a;color:#fff}a.pp__discussion-highlight-button--first-mention{border:2px solid #9b9b9b;color:#fff;background-color:#9b9b9b}a.pp__discussion-highlight-button--first-mention:hover{border:2px solid #606060;background-color:#606060}.pp__review-highlight{display:-webkit-flex;display:flex}.pp__review-highlight-author{font-style:italic}.pp__review-highlight-synopsis p:not(.pp__review-highlight-author) a{color:#000;cursor:pointer}.pp__review-highlight-synopsis p:not(.pp__review-highlight-author) a:hover{border-bottom:none}.pp__review-highlight-synopsis img{height:16px;margin-right:.5em;vertical-align:baseline}.pp__review-highlight-actions{min-width:40px;box-sizing:border-box;padding-top:20px;margin-left:10px}.pp__review-highlight-actions a:hover{border-bottom:none}.pp__right-chevron{display:block;border:none;background-color:transparent;background-image:url(/board/images/style-99/product-page/right-chevron.png);background-repeat:no-repeat;background-position:center;background-size:16px;height:40px;width:40px;cursor:pointer}span.pp__featured-review-badge{display:inline-block;border:2px solid #f2c500;border-radius:3px;font-size:14px;padding:2px 4px 1px;font-weight:700;color:#f2c500;background-color:rgba(242,197,0,.05)}.pp__review-highlight--featured .pp__review-highlight-synopsis p{margin-top:5px}.pp__review-highlight--featured .pp__review-highlight-actions{padding-top:31px}.pp__review-highlight--featured .pp__review-highlight-synopsis img{vertical-align:text-bottom}.pp__review-breakdown{margin:20px 0;display:-webkit-flex;display:flex}.pp__review-breakdown-bit{margin-right:30px;box-sizing:border-box;position:relative}.pp__review-breakdown-bit--avg-score{height:90px;width:90px;border:1px solid #dadada;border-radius:5px;background-color:#f7f7f7;color:#606060;text-align:center}span.pp__avg-score{font-family:open_sans,Helvetica,sans-serif;position:absolute}.pp__review-breakdown-bit--avg-score .pp__avg-score--score{top:28px;right:0;left:0;font-size:22px;font-weight:700}.pp__review-breakdown-bit--avg-score .pp__avg-score--outof{font-weight:100;position:absolute;bottom:0;font-size:14px;right:2px}.pp__star-rating-breakdown{height:14px;margin-bottom:5px;overflow:hidden}.pp__star-rating-breakdown:last-of-type{margin-bottom:0}.pp__star-rating-breakdown span{display:inline-block;height:14px;overflow:hidden;font-size:14px;width:60px;font-weight:700;color:#606060}.pp__star-rating-breakdown span:first-of-type{text-align:right;margin-right:5px;font-weight:400}.pp__star-rating-breakdown span:last-of-type{width:auto}.pp__star-rating-breakdown span.pp__score-slider{width:100px;background-color:#f7f7f7;height:14px;margin-right:5px}.pp__star-rating-breakdown span.pp__score-slider span.pp__score-slider-score{background-color:#f2c500;width:0;margin-right:0}.pp__avg-score-breakdown{height:18.75px;margin-bottom:5px}.pp__avg-score-breakdown:last-of-type{margin-bottom:0}.pp__avg-score-breakdown img{height:18.75px;vertical-align:text-bottom;margin-right:5px}.pp__avg-score-breakdown span{font-weight:700;font-size:14px;color:#606060}.pp__highlights-card--product-description p{margin-top:26px}.pp__highlights-card-action-links a{margin-right:15px}.pp__video-guides-video{margin-top:26px}.pp__video-guides-video iframe{max-width:100%}.pp__video-guides-thumbnails{margin-top:15px;text-align:center}.pp__product-video-thumbnail{height:40px;width:84px;border:1px solid #dadada;border-radius:3px;background-color:#f7f7f7;margin:0 5px;box-sizing:border-box;cursor:pointer;text-align:center;font-size:16px}.pp__product-video-thumbnail:focus{outline:0}.pp__product-video-thumbnail:hover{border-color:#606060}.pp__product-video-thumbnail:hover i{color:#606060}.pp__product-video-thumbnail--selected,.pp__product-video-thumbnail--selected:hover{border-color:#38407a;background-color:#9b9fbc}.pp__product-video-thumbnail--selected i,.pp__product-video-thumbnail--selected i:hover,.pp__product-video-thumbnail--selected:hover i{color:#38407a}.pp__breadcrumbs{margin-bottom:15px}.pp__breadcrumbs--bottom{margin-bottom:0;padding-top:15px}a.pp__breadcrumb{display:inline-block;background-color:#fff;border:1px solid #38407a;border-right:none;font-size:13px;font-weight:700;color:#38407a;border-top-left-radius:3px;border-bottom-left-radius:3px;padding:6px 8px 4px;position:relative;z-index:0;margin-right:15px;margin-bottom:5px}a.pp__breadcrumb:not(.pp__breadcrumb--leaf):before{content:"";position:absolute;top:2.5px;left:calc(100% - 9px);width:17px;height:17px;border-top:1px solid #38407a;border-right:1px solid #38407a;background-color:transparent;border-top-right-radius:3px;border-top-left-radius:1px;border-bottom-right-radius:1px;transform:rotate(45deg);z-index:-1}a.pp__breadcrumb:hover:before{background-color:#38407a}a.pp__breadcrumb:hover{background-color:#38407a;color:#fff;border-bottom:1px solid #38407a}a.pp__breadcrumb--leaf{border:1px solid #38407a;border-radius:3px;background-color:#38407a;color:#fff;font-weight:700}a.pp__breadcrumb--leaf:hover{background-color:#9b9fbc;color:#38407a}.pp__mobile-smart-navigation{display:none}.pp__shopping{position:absolute!important;top:0;right:0;left:20px;height:100%}.pp__shopping #productpage-bnb-stack{display:none}.pp__support--mobile{max-height:200px}.pp__support .support{border-top:1px solid #e5e5e5;border-bottom:1px solid #e5e5e5;-webkit-transition-duration:none;transition-duration:none;-webkit-transition-property:none;transition-property:none;padding-top:30px}.pp__support .support::after{content:'SPONSORED';position:absolute;top:5px;left:5px;color:#e5e5e5}.pp__support .support:hover{background-color:#f5f5f5}.pp__support .support h2{color:#f76a0b;font-size:21px}.pp__support .support a{margin:0 auto;max-width:720px}.pp__support .support p{color:#000}#MobilePPAdBanner,#TabletPPAdBanner{height:auto;padding:0;display:block}#MobilePPAdBanner_iframe,#TabletPPAdBanner_iframe{width:100%!important;height:auto;min-height:33.33vw!important;max-width:600px!important;max-height:200px!important}#TabletPPAdBanner_iframe{min-height:1px!important;max-width:728px!important;max-height:90px!important}.pp__container .bnb--square{overflow:hidden}.pp__container .itemlist-facet__vendor-fallback-card a:hover,.pp__container a.vendor-card.vendor-card--text,.pp__container a.vendor-card.vendor-card--text:hover{border-bottom:none}.pp__container .item-container__right-col a:hover,.pp__container .itemlist-facet>a:hover{border-bottom:none}.pp__container .item-container__right-col a,.pp__container .item-container__right-col span,.pp__container .vendor-card.vendor-card--text span{font-size:12.8px;font-family:Metropolis;color:#38407a;letter-spacing:.128px}.pp__container .bnb__facet-title{font-family:open_sans,Helvetica,Arial,sans-serif;font-weight:100;font-size:18px;color:#333;margin-bottom:15px}.pp__container .bnb__facet-title--itemlist{margin-bottom:-5px}.pp__container .vendor-card--text i{color:#fff}html{-webkit-text-size-adjust:100%}.rsContainer--outline-hotfix{transform:none!important}.pp__mobile-shopping{display:none}.pp__header-shortcut-links a,.pp__highlights-card-action-links a{border-bottom:2px solid #38407a}.pp__highlights-card{margin-top:20px}.pp__highlights-card--discussions,.pp__highlights-card--product-description,.pp__highlights-card--reviews,.pp__highlights-card--video-guides{border:none;background:#fff;box-shadow:0 1px 4px 0 rgba(0,0,0,.5);padding:20px 10px;margin-left:0;margin-right:0;border-radius:5px}@media screen and (max-width:1200px){.pp__review-breakdown{display:none}}@media screen and (max-width:1023px){.pp__container{padding:0}.pp__left-col{padding-top:20px;padding-left:20px;padding-bottom:20px}.pp__right-col{flex:0 0 240px;background-color:#f7f7f7;border-left:1px solid #dadada}.pp__highlights-card-header--reviews{margin-bottom:20px}.pp__highlights-card-action-links{text-align:center;margin:20px 0 0 0}.pp__video-guides-video{text-align:center}.pp__review-breakdown{display:none}.pp__shopping #productpage-bnb-square{display:none}}@media screen and (min-width:768px) and (max-width:1023px){.pp__shopping #productpage-bnb-stack{display:block;width:205px!important}.pp__right-col{padding-left:16px;padding-top:20px}.pp__shopping{top:20px;left:16px}.pp__container .bnb__facet-title,.pp__container .bnb__facet-title--itemlist{margin-bottom:16px}}@media screen and (max-width:767px){.pp__left-col{padding:10px}.pp__right-col{display:none}.pp__breadcrumbs{display:none}.pp__container .pp__breadcrumb{width:calc(100% - 15px);box-sizing:border-box;font-size:18px;font-weight:400;height:40px;line-height:28px}.pp__container a.pp__breadcrumb:before{top:4.5px;left:calc(100% - 15px);width:28px;height:27.5px;border-top-right-radius:3px;border-top-left-radius:1px;border-bottom-right-radius:1px}a.pp__breadcrumb.pp__breadcrumb--root{background-color:#38407a;color:#fff}.pp__container a.pp__breadcrumb.pp__breadcrumb--root:before{background-color:#38407a}.pp__product-images,.pp__product-images img{max-height:200px}.pp__container h1{font-size:28px}.pp__container h2{font-size:21px}.pp__highlights-card{margin-top:20px}.pp__highlights-card--discussions,.pp__highlights-card--product-description,.pp__highlights-card--reviews{border:none;background:#fff;box-shadow:0 1px 4px 0 rgba(0,0,0,.5);padding:20px 10px;margin-left:0;margin-right:0;border-radius:5px}.pp__mobile-smart-navigation{display:block;margin-top:20px}a.pp__smartnav-link{display:block;width:100%;font-size:18px;color:#606060;border-bottom:1px solid #dadada;position:relative;height:50px;font-family:open_sans,Helvetica,Arial,sans-serif;line-height:50px;padding-left:20px;box-sizing:border-box}a.pp__smartnav-link .pp__right-chevron{position:absolute;right:0;top:5px}.pp__support{margin:10px -10px -10px -10px}.pp__mobile-shopping{display:block;margin-left:-10px;margin-right:-10px;border-radius:0;margin-top:20px}.pp__mobile-shopping .bnb{padding:0;box-shadow:none}.pp__mobile-shopping .bnb-container{transition:all 250ms ease-out}.pp__mobile-shopping .bnb__facet--vendors{background-color:#f7f7f7;border-top:1px solid #dadada;padding:10px}.pp__mobile-shopping .bnb__facet--itemlist{border-bottom:1px solid #dadada;padding:0 10px 10px}.pp__highlights-card--product-description .product-description__text{max-height:calc(15 * 1.1em + 42px);overflow:hidden;box-sizing:border-box}}